This role is based in the BioSample Management Group, which is dedicated to providing crucial support for clinical studies. As a Biosample Coordinator, you will ensure the seamless execution of sample management and clinical tracking. The dynamic nature of this department offers you the opportunity to lead process improvements while supporting all phases of clinical operations.
The Opportunity
You support the clinical department by assisting with the execution and maintenance of clinical studies, preparing materials, and attending investigator meetings.
You establish, update, and maintain clinical tracking databases and clinical operations files to ensure accurate documentation.
Youassist withthe shipping, inventory, or sample destruction for remaining material for each clinical trial.
You receive, triage, and accession sample shipments while performing rigorous quality control checks on demographic data and sample labeling.
You coordinate both internal and client requests, facilitating global sample shipments while maintaining an accurate chain of custody.
You track incoming and outgoing clinical and regulatory documents, and process, log, and distribute completed case report forms.
Youwork with teamleads onprocess improvement workstreams within the BioSample Management Group andhelp manage team emails to ensure all deliverables are met.
